Dengue
Dengue is caused by the dengue virus and is mainly transmitted through the bite of infected Aedes mosquitoes. These mosquitoes can be active during the day as well as at other times, making mosquito protection important in affected areas.
The illness can range from a mild fever to a potentially life-threatening condition. Most people recover with appropriate supportive care, but some develop severe dengue involving bleeding, fluid leakage, shock, or organ complications.
Because symptoms can overlap with other infections, it is important not to assume that every fever is dengue.
Common Symptoms of Dengue
Dengue commonly begins with a sudden fever. Other symptoms may include:
- Severe headache
- Pain behind the eyes
- Muscle and joint pain
- Nausea or vomiting
- Extreme tiredness
- Skin rash
- Mild bleeding, such as bleeding from the nose or gums
- Reduced appetite
Symptoms can vary from one person to another. Some patients may experience only a few symptoms, while others become considerably unwell.
Why Early Assessment Matters
Dengue can change during the course of the illness. A person may initially appear stable but later develop warning signs, particularly around the period when the fever begins to settle.
This is one reason medical assessment should not be based only on whether the temperature is currently high. The duration of illness, symptoms, hydration, medical history, and laboratory findings may all be important.

Can Dengue Be Diagnosed Completely Online?
Usually, dengue cannot be reliably confirmed through an online consultation alone.
Symptoms can suggest dengue, but they are not specific enough to prove that a person has the infection. Other viral infections and illnesses can cause similar symptoms.
Blood testing may be recommended depending on the stage of illness and the patient's symptoms. Tests can include dengue antigen or molecular testing during certain stages of infection and antibody testing at other stages. A complete blood count may also be useful for monitoring platelet levels and other blood-related changes.
Therefore, Online doctor consultation in islamabad is best viewed as part of the assessment process rather than a substitute for diagnostic testing when testing is medically indicated.
Why Blood Tests May Be Recommended
Blood tests can provide information that symptoms alone cannot.
A complete blood count may help doctors monitor platelet counts, white blood cell levels, and other changes. However, platelet count should not be considered the only measurement of dengue severity. Doctors also consider the patient's symptoms, hydration, circulation, bleeding, hematocrit, and overall clinical condition.
Dengue-specific tests can help determine whether a patient has evidence of infection, depending on when the test is performed.
A doctor can advise which test is appropriate based on the day of illness and clinical situation.

Warning Signs That Need Urgent Medical Care
Online consultation should not delay emergency treatment when serious symptoms are present.
Warning signs can include severe abdominal pain, persistent vomiting, bleeding, extreme weakness, difficulty breathing, confusion, fainting, severe restlessness, or signs of shock.
Very little urine, inability to drink fluids, significant dehydration, or rapidly worsening symptoms should also be taken seriously.
If a patient appears seriously ill, emergency medical services or the nearest appropriate healthcare facility should be contacted rather than waiting for a virtual appointment.
Why the Fever Going Down Does Not Always Mean Recovery
One important feature of dengue is that serious complications can occur around the time the fever decreases. A patient may therefore feel that the illness is ending when closer observation is actually needed.
This makes the timing of symptoms important. Patients should continue monitoring their condition even after the temperature improves.

What Treatment Is Usually Considered?
There is no routine specific antiviral medicine that cures dengue. Treatment is generally supportive and focuses on maintaining hydration, managing fever and discomfort safely, and monitoring for complications.
Doctors commonly advise appropriate fluid intake when the patient can drink normally. Oral fluids may include water and suitable electrolyte-containing drinks, depending on the individual's needs.
For fever and pain, a healthcare professional may recommend an appropriate medicine such as acetaminophen/paracetamol when suitable.
Patients with suspected dengue should not casually take medicines such as aspirin or ibuprofen because they can increase bleeding risk in some circumstances. Medication choices should be discussed with a qualified healthcare professional.
Avoiding Dehydration
Maintaining adequate fluid intake is an important part of dengue care.
Patients should follow their doctor's advice and monitor whether they are able to drink and urinate normally. Repeated vomiting can make hydration difficult and may require medical evaluation.
Signs such as severe dizziness, very low urine output, unusual sleepiness, or inability to keep fluids down require prompt attention.
Who May Need Closer Monitoring?
Some people may have a greater risk of complications or may require closer medical supervision.
These can include young children, older adults, pregnant individuals, and people with conditions such as diabetes, kidney disease, heart disease, or other significant medical problems.
A previous dengue infection may also be relevant because different dengue virus types and subsequent infections can affect risk.

Limitations of Virtual Assessment
Online consultation cannot completely replace physical examination.
A doctor may be unable to assess certain signs accurately through a phone or computer. Blood pressure, pulse quality, abdominal tenderness, hydration status, and other physical findings may require an in-person examination.
Laboratory testing may also be necessary to support diagnosis and monitor the illness.
For this reason, patients should follow the doctor's recommendation if an in-person visit is advised.

How to Reduce Dengue Risk at Home
Medical assessment is only one part of dengue prevention. Reducing mosquito exposure is also important.
Use mosquito repellent according to its instructions and consider wearing clothing that covers the arms and legs. Window screens, mosquito nets, and other protective measures can reduce exposure.
Standing water around homes should be removed where possible. Containers, plant trays, buckets, discarded items, and other places that collect water can provide mosquito breeding sites.
If someone in the household has dengue, preventing additional mosquito bites can also help reduce the possibility of mosquitoes acquiring the virus from that person and transmitting it to others.
